Turn toilet paper rolls and aluminum foil into silver napkin rings for your table setting.

Easy 9,294 views

What You'll Need

  • 6-8 empty toilet paper rolls (or paper towel rolls, cut down)
  • 1 roll standard aluminum foil
  • Craft glue (PVA, white school glue, or tacky glue)
  • Scissors
  • Ruler
  • Pencil
  • Craft knife (optional, for cleaner cuts)
  • Cutting mat (if using craft knife)
  • Small brush or applicator (optional, for glue)

Use empty toilet paper rolls and aluminum foil to make metallic napkin rings. Quantities are for 6-8 rings.

Step 1: Prepare the Bases

Measure and mark each toilet paper roll at 1 to 1.5 inches (2.5-3.8 cm) wide. Cut along the marks with scissors or a craft knife on a cutting mat. You need 6-8 rings.

Step 2: Wrap with Foil

Cut aluminum foil pieces large enough to wrap around each ring with a 1/2 inch (1.2 cm) overlap. Apply a thin layer of glue to the outside of the ring, then press the foil over it, smoothing out wrinkles. Fold the foil edges inside the ring.

Step 3: Smooth and Dry

Use the back of a spoon or your finger to press the foil firmly against the ring, removing air bubbles. Let the glue dry completely, about 30-60 minutes.

Step 4: Finish and Use

Trim any excess foil from the edges. Slide a napkin through each ring and set the table.

Tip

Cut all rings to the same width for a uniform set.

Tip

For a smoother finish, use the back of a spoon to press the foil.
